Meanings and Origins of the name Ada Jane
The name Ada has origins that can be traced back to several cultures. In Germanic roots, Ada means "noble" or "nobility," reflecting a sense of dignity and grace. It is also derived from the Hebrew name Adah, which means "adorned" or "ornament," suggesting beauty and elegance. This multi-faceted origin story adds layers of richness to the name's history.
The middle name Jane has an equally esteemed background. Jane is the English form of the Hebrew name Yochanan, meaning "God is gracious." Often associated with a humble and gracious personality, Jane brings a spiritual depth to the name combination. Together, Ada Jane harmonizes a sense of noble allure and gentle spirituality.
Combining Ada and Jane creates a name that is not only melodious but also imbued with meanings that honor both heritage and character. This name celebrates both inner beauty and noble spirit, making it a wonderful choice for parents looking for a name with depth and reverence.
Popularity of the name Ada Jane
Ada Jane has enjoyed varying degrees of popularity over the years. Its timeless appeal means it has never completely disappeared from the naming charts, even as trends come and go. In the late 19th and early 20th centuries, Ada was quite popular, a favorite among baby names in English-speaking countries. The resurgence of vintage names has seen Ada make a comeback in recent years, often accompanied by equally classic middle names like Jane.
In the United States, Ada steadily rises in popularity, especially as parents look for names that are both distinct and historically rich. Jane, often used as a middle name, complements Ada perfectly, creating an elegant, balanced name well-received in modern times.
Globally, Ada Jane maintains a more boutique status, cherished for its timeless qualities. In countries across Europe, such as the United Kingdom and Germany, Ada enjoys a respectable position among parents who appreciate its noble connotations. Similarly, the name Jane, while classic, remains less common in these regions, making Ada Jane a unique and harmonious duo.
